Ethics is basically a branch of Philosophy. It concerns the proper conduct and good living in the society. It emphasizes on the principle of "Good Life" which is satisfying.

There are many types of ethics such as:

- Normative Ethics

- Meta-Ethics

- Descriptive Ethics

- Relational Ethics

- Applies Ethics

- Evolutionary Ethics

Business EthicsBusiness ethics is basically a type of principle of applied ethics, which analyzes various ethical rules and ethical or moral problems that may take place in a commercial environment. In the 21st Century, one of the most significant aspects of the commercial marketplaces all over the world is the growing focus on conscience. As a result, the necessity for highly ethical business practices (which is also referred as ethicism) is on the rise. At the same time, force is also being applied on businesses and industries for the development of business ethics with the help of novel public efforts and regulations (for example, increased amount of road tax in the United Kingdom for vehicles with higher emission). 

Business ethics can take the form of a descriptive field (subject area ) or normative field. The descriptive discipline is applied in the academic world. The normative discipline is basically implemented as a corporate device and it is also utilized in the form of career specialization. 

The number and degree of business ethical issues gives the evidence of how much a business is compliant with the social values (non-economic). 

The different forms of business ethics can be categorized into the following types: 

General business ethics

These ethics deal with the following issues:

Corporate social responsibility (CSR)

Fiduciary responsibility

Corporate governance

Industrial espionage

Hostile take-overs

Corporate manslaughter

Political contributions

Professional business ethics

The professional business ethics can be categorized into the following types: 

Ethics of human resource management (HRM)

Discrimination issues

Strike breaking or union busting

Drug testing

Workplace surveillance

Whistle-blowing

Occupational safety and health

Employment law

Indentured servitude

Ethics of accounting information

Kickbacks

Creative accounting

Earnings management

Misleading financial analysis

Insider trading

Securities fraud

Bucket shop

Forex scams

Executive compensation

Bribery

Facilitation payments

Ethics of production

Harmful, addictive, or defective products

Environmental ethics

Pollution

Carbon emissions trading

Health

Mobile phone radiation

Genetically modified food

Product testing ethics like animal testing and animal rights

Ethics of sales and marketing

Pricing: Price discrimination, price fixing, price skimming

Anticompetitive practices

Particular marketing strategies: Greenwash, shill, bait and switch, spam (computer), viral

marketing, pyramid scheme, and planned obsolescence

Advertisement contents: Attack ads or promos, sex in advertisements, and subliminal messages

Marketing in schools

Grey markets and black markets

Ethics of intellectual property, skills, and knowledge

Patent infringement, trademark infringement, copyright infringement

Patent misuse, patent troll, copyright misuse, submarine patent

Employee raiding

Biopiracy and bioprospecting

Industrial espionage

Business intelligence

International business ethics

Transfer pricing

Fair trade pricing

Cultural imperialism

Globalization

Child labor

A large number of companies are appointing business ethics officers as a part of their compliance and ethics programs, and these officers are also known as risk and compliance officers.
